#337140 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#337140 is composed of 20% red, 44.3% green and 25.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 54.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 43.4% yellow and 55.7% black. It has a hue angle of 132.6 degrees, a saturation of 37.8% and a lightness of 32.2%. #337140 color hex could be obtained by blending #66e280 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336633.

Shades and Tints of #337140

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020503 is the darkest color, while #f6fbf7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#337140

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4c584f is the less saturated color, while #01a323 is the most saturated one.
